Output d8be633d98c3f9237a9ad1c868802d2d97c5be7f50eaaab854cb79584ac91653:3

value
526000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b3fc753dcaecd008a0e64cfc9065405db37910 OP_EQUAL
address
3MGG9Fec5KtCynxG8qXk7jD1guycYEqiaE
transaction
d8be633d98c3f9237a9ad1c868802d2d97c5be7f50eaaab854cb79584ac91653
spent
true